#684225 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#684225 is composed of 40.8% red, 25.9%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.5% magenta, 64.4%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 26 degrees, a saturation of 47.5% and a lightness of 27.6%. #684225 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0844a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#684225 color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
The hexadecimal color #684225 has RGB values of R:104, G:66,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.64,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 6832677.
